Social security in focus: Women receive $ 354 a month less than men
The average Social Security check for women is much less than for men. In May 2022, men received an average of about $ 1,848 a month, USA Today reported. In contrast, the average monthly check for women was only $ 1,494 per month. month – a difference of about $ 354 per month. month, or $ 4,248 per. year.
Well, that’s interesting: Biden cancels more student debt
The Biden administration said it would cancel the federal SU loans debt of about 200,000 borrowers who claimed to be scammed by their schools.
